CostQuest Applauds Court Ruling Affirming FCC Map Award

CostQuest applauded the U.S. Court of Federal Claims' decision affirming its FCC contract to build the broadband serviceable location fabric. The court rejected LightBox's challenge of the award after the GAO dismissed and denied an earlier bid protest (see 2203110040).…
